If you are fortunate enough to have your own garden, then it is a really good idea that you do what you can to use your outdoor space as efficiently as possible so you can get the most out of it. Below, you will find some good ideas to help you do just that.
Zone it
Creating a number of different zones for your garden space is a good way to ensure it can be used efficiently for the whole family. For example, you might love sitting with a good book in the garden, whereas the kids might love running around playing football out there, if you create dedicated zones for sitting, playing, growing vegetables, and whatever else you like to do, and separate them with hedgerows, then everyone can do what they love in the space without impacting too much in the other, so everyone wins. Why Hedgerowa? Because they are great at absorbing sound and catching flyaway balls so they don’t end up hitting someone!

Use planters
If you want to grow things in your garden, then using raised planter beds as well as plant pots, is a good way to do it, because it means you will not have to give over a huge amount of lawn space to the plants and flowers, and it will also be a lot easier for you to move them around should you decide you want to do something different with the garden or because they will get more light in a new location when winter comes around, and…well, you get the idea with that.
Keep things neat
Making sure that hedges are neatly trimmed and trees are not allowed to become overgrown will mean that there is more useable space available to you and your family in the garden, no matter whether you want to use the space for dining, relaxing, playing or actually growing your own fruits and vegetables. So, even if you do not particularly enjoy gardening, keeping things neat, or paying a gardener to do so, will definitely pay off in your enjoyment of the garden space.
